Analysis
In 2026, average area burnt per wildfire in Portugal stood at 184.46 hectares.
That represents a change of down 47.1% on the previous year and down 13.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, average area burnt per wildfire in Portugal peaked at 348.52 hectares in 2025 and was at its lowest, 130.11 hectares, in 2021.
That places Portugal 144th out of 181 countries with data for 2026,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 15 years of available data.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2010s | 177.75 hectares | 133.77 hectares | 256.9 hectares | 8 |
| 2020s | 221.17 hectares | 130.11 hectares | 348.52 hectares | 7 |
